Multilogin vs Alias Browser at a glance
| Capability | Alias Browser | Multilogin |
|---|---|---|
| Profiles | Unlimited | Tiered by plan |
| Free tier | Yes — unlimited profiles | No meaningful free tier |
| Account required to run | No · zero telemetry | Yes, cloud account |
| Engines | Chromium & Firefox (Camoufox) | Chromium (Mimic) & Firefox (Stealthfox) |
| Per-profile proxy & VPN | Built in (incl. WireGuard) | Proxy (BYO); built-in proxies on some plans |
| Automation | REST API + MCP server, included | API + Selenium/Puppeteer, plan-dependent |
| AI-agent ready (MCP) | Yes, native | No |
| Self-hostable sync | Yes (E2E encrypted) | No — profiles in vendor cloud |
| Platforms | macOS, Windows, Linux (x64 + arm64) | macOS, Windows, Linux |
Details vary by plan and change over time; check each vendor's current pricing before deciding. For a three-way comparison including GoLogin, see Alias vs Multilogin vs GoLogin.

When Multilogin is still the right choice
Multilogin's decade of anti-detect R&D, team-permission system, and large knowledge base make it a safe pick for big agencies with compliance requirements and budgets to match. How to migrate
- Download Alias Browser (free, no account).
- Recreate each identity as a fresh Alias profile — fresh fingerprints are safer than clones.
- Assign per-profile proxies (which type to use).
- Import cookies for accounts you control to preserve sessions.
- Verify your new fingerprints with the fingerprint checker.
